EN 60204-1 is the primary European harmonized standard for the electrical safety of industrial machinery, ensuring protection against hazards up to 1000V AC or 1500V DC. Compliance with this standard, covering areas such as isolation, earthing, and controls, is essential for meeting EU directives and CE marking requirements. Read the full summary on Scribd.
